Marble Falls is right on the Highland Lakes chain — you can practically walk to the water, with four guided lakes within 25 minutes.

Closest lakes we guide

Lake Marble Falls ~5 min top pick

Guided Lake Marble Falls bass fishing - a compact Highland Lakes producer, ideal for a focused half-day on the water.

Lake LBJ ~15 min

Guided Lake LBJ bass fishing - a consistent, constant-level lake that fishes shallow, great for kids, and a Guadalupe bass stronghold.

Inks Lake ~20 min

Guided Inks Lake bass fishing - a small, scenic Highland lake giving up quality bass in a beautiful state-park setting.

Lake Buchanan ~25 min

Guided Lake Buchanan bass fishing - Central Texas's best winter lake and a true trophy fishery, plus big striper.
